How did it all start ?

We started from the observation that students are bored in museums and do not take advantage of this opportunity. It was therefore necessary to reinvent the experience that students have in museums but especially that of teachers too; giving lessons to students who are not interested ends up boring us too. That's why we thought of an application that would reinvent the experience of teachers in museums. For this reason, it is quite naturally that we thought of sound design because among us, we have Jovan who is passionate about it.

Context

when? where? who? why?

Our project is mainly aimed at enhancing the museum visit experience for teachers by providing a better teaching and learning environment for teachers and students. We target museums all over the world, of all kind. As we all know, a museum by itself is very encompassing,teachers find it difficult to maintain a healthy and an enthusiastic environment throughtout the visit. During the visit, the students often lose their concentration and end up losing their interest for the visit. To make it more enhacing for the teacher and to keep the students engaged throughout their time in the museums, we offer a special personalised track to students based on sound design,allowing them to carry out their own way of exploring the museum,being supervised by the teacher.

The teacher will also have information about each student and their location in the museum,also able to talk to them and guide them about the various artifacts.Our product mainly focuses on making the musuem visit experience less monotonous for the children and also enable the teacher to better deliver lessons through the visit. Nevertheless, since we need to make students equally interested in other areas as well, our museum tour is designed in such a way that by the end of the visit, each student has accessed all the parts of the museum

Service offered

what? how?

The Perfect Guide is an Android and iOS application that enhances museum visits.Teachers and students can download the appication and enter the name of the museum they are visiting and the teacher additionally enters the details of his/her name and the number of students.The teacher will be able to play different sounds played based on the artifacts in the museum. For example, there might be sounds of war denoting the war ruins in the museum, sounds of ancient civilisation,sounds of dinosaurs,voices of painters,etc. All of these sounds stem from sound design artists. As we can not really reproduce a dinosaur voice or a bombing scene, sound design will help us to create thousands of different voices and sounces for the app. Each student has to choose their favourite theme based on the audio played. The teacher will then get the results of the choices of the students. The students are made into groups based on their selection,forming their respective groups. The teacher then directs the individual groups in their respective paths based on the option they chose. Throughout the tour, students will be guided by innovative sound designs associated with the artifacts through their headphones.The teacher will be able to locate the groups through GPS and also provide them narratives. The students can also interact with the teacher at any point during the tour through the app thanks to a chatting service. He/she can ask questions to the teacher or report any emergency. Finally, the tour also makes every student visit every place in the museum,making it a wholesome experience for the students. At the end of the visit, the teacher will have access to a plethora of information such as the path followed by each group, time spent by the groups at each point,their ratings of each artifact,questions asked by the students,etc.

The application for the teacher will initially have the results page of the survey, with the graphs of the responses by the students. The application then groups the students automatically with their usernames. Each group page will have information about the group members like location, audio being played and time spent by the each member. There will also be a pause option available to both teacher and the student allowing to provide narratives and ask questions respectively.
